Collingwood has officially parted ways with Dayne Beams after reaching a settlement on the final two years of the AFL premiership winner's contract.He took a break from the game late last year to deal with mental health issuesBeams's departure is one of three changes to the Magpies' playing list ahead of December's national draft, with Rupert Wills and Flynn Appleby delisted.and sat out the entire 2020 season before announcing his retirement last month.
"Some time ago it became apparent to me that the demands of the game, which for many years I thrived on, were not helping my recovery," Beams said in a Magpies statement."I am a father to two lovely children and a husband to Kelly, who I owe so much to. "I have many teammates and staff at Collingwood to thank for helping me through a particularly tough time," Beams said.
